I am curious how the writers will finish this show. Jung Se-ok (Park Eun-bin) is the talented neurosurgeon who lost her license because of her mentor Dr. Choi Deok-hee (Sul Kyung-gu). Unlike other dramas, she deserved it because she is totally wild, selfish and violent. After losing her license she become a illegal neurosurgeon for hire and also a psycho killer (similar to 'Dexter').

This series delves into the psyche of the human mind, showing how every action leads to another. It demonstrates that a 'good' person is not always good, and a 'bad' person is not always bad either. How certain circumstances and experiences can drastically change a person.
Park Eun-Bin's first-ever sinister role, showcases her wide range of acting skills. Well prepared cast, plot and direction. The series also dives into complex ethical medical dilemmas, adding layers of moral conflict that keep things gripping. The first two episodes were already intense, which keeps me coming back for more.
